Experience
Professional roles, leadership positions, and contributions to the tech community
Director of Development
ACM UTD
Technologies
Oversee ACM UTD's largest division, managing 6 project teams and 45 officers to build and maintain software serving hundreds of ACM members and thousands of UTD students while driving recruiting, planning, and cross-divisional initiatives.
Key Highlights
Software Engineer Intern
J.P. Morgan Chase & Co.
Technologies
Worked on the Connected Banking Import Aggregation team, delivering backend and full-stack solutions to improve vendor outage handling, system reliability, and engineer efficiency.
Key Highlights
Development Lead
ACM UTD
Technologies
Led end-to-end development of SAGE, an AI-powered academic advising platform, overseeing system design, sprint planning, and team coordination while ensuring scalability and maintainability.
Key Highlights
Fullstack Software Developer Intern
Verizon
Technologies
Worked on the Database Engineering team to improve observability and database performance analysis through self-service tools, automation, and compliance-focused solutions.
Key Highlights
Software Developer Intern
Voxai Solutions
Technologies
Worked on the .NET Development team building migration tools, AWS serverless functions, and custom front-end solutions to support enterprise contact center clients transitioning to Genesys Cloud.